At 15:17 today, my country used the Long March 2D carrier rocket/Yuanzheng 3 upper stage at the Jiuquan Satellite Launch Center.The high-speed laser diamond constellation test system was successfully launched into space, and the five satellites successfully entered the predetermined orbit. The launch mission was a complete success.
According to reports, the Long March 2D carrier rocket and the Yuanzheng 3 upper stage were both developed by the Eighth Academy of China Aerospace Science and Technology Corporation.
The Long March-2D carrier rocket has the ability to launch into different orbits from the three satellite launch centers of Jiuquan, Taiyuan and Xichang. Its 700-kilometer sun-synchronous orbit has a carrying capacity of 1.3 tons.
The Yuanzheng-3 upper stage is called the "space bus" and has the capability of more than 20 independent fast-orbit maneuver deployments. It is mainly used for off-orbit multi-satellite deployment missions.
The mission profile is complex. During the orbit transfer process, since the satellites "sitting" in different positions have to "get off" in sequence, the upper stage and satellite assembly are in a state of large lateral center of mass deviation.
To this end, the "Space Bus" uses the adaptive capability of the center of mass of the control system and the two-way swing capability of the main engine to steadily deliver "passengers" to different destinations.After completing its mission, the "space bus" ignited again and actively deorbited.
This mission is the 551st flight of the Long March series of launch vehicles.
